
The One-Millisecond Update That Almost Melted Production
The alert came in at 2:13 a.m. Arman’s phone buzzed on the nightstand with the familiar, unwelcome vibration that every developer learns to dread. The message was short and blunt: Production CPU usage: 96% He squinted at the screen. “That’s… not great.” Five minutes later he was at his desk, hoodie half-zipped, staring at the monitoring dashboard like it had personally betrayed him. The graphs looked like mountains. CPU spikes everywhere. Memory climbing. Request latency stretching into the seconds. The strange part was the traffic. There wasn’t any. The site had maybe twelve active users. “Twelve people,” Arman said quietly, “should not require the power output of a small power plant.” He opened the logs. They weren’t helpful. Requests looked normal. No infinite loops in the backend. No database explosions. No obvious culprits. Then he noticed something strange in the browser performance tab. The frontend CPU usage was also sky-high. That narrowed things down. “Alright,” he muttered,
Continue reading on Dev.to JavaScript
Opens in a new tab

